中文 / EN

4007-702-802

4007-702-802

Follow us on:

关注网络营销公司微信关注上海网站建设公司新浪微博
上海曼朗策划领先的数字整合营销服务商Request Diagnosis Report
Building an IoT Platform: A Comprehensive Guide to Developing and Deploying Conneed Solutions_上海曼朗策划网络营销策划公司
About the companyMedia reportsContact UsMan Lang: Homepage » About Man Lang » Media reports

Building an IoT Platform: A Comprehensive Guide to Developing and Deploying Conneed Solutions

The source of the article:ManLang    Publishing date:2024-09-21    Shared by:

返回

Abstra: This article serves as a comprehensive guide to building an Internet of Things (IoT) platform, detailing the necessary components and phases involved in developing and deploying conneed solutions. It begins by outlining the fundamental elements of an effeive IoT architeure, which includes sensors, communication protocols, data management, and application solutions. Next, it delves into the developmental stages essential for a successful IoT implementation, emphasizing the importance of planning, prototyping, and scaling solutions to meet user demands. Following this, the article addresses security considerations critical to safeguarding IoT environments from vulnerabilities and threats. Finally, the guide discusses the future trends in IoT, including edge computing and AI integration, which are shaping the next generation of conneed solutions. Readers will gain insights and praical tips for realizing their IoT vision through a struured approach to building a robust platform.

1. Understanding IoT Architeure

Building an effeive IoT platform starts with a sound understanding of the IoT architeure. This foundation comprises several interdependent components that work harmoniously to enable seamless conneivity and data flow. At its core, the architeure consists of sensors or devices that colle data from their environment. These sensors may encompass a range of technologies, such as temperature gauges, motion deteors, and smart meters, each serving a specific funion within the IoT ecosystem.

The next crucial layer in the IoT architeure is the communication protocols that facilitate data transmission between devices and the central processing unit or cloud service. Various protocols, like MQTT (Message Queuing Telemetry Transport) and CoAP (Constrained Application Protocol), have been designed specifically for IoT applications, optimizing bandwidth usage and enhancing communication efficiency. Choosing the right protocol depends on the specific requirements of the application, including latency, network conditions, and the complexity of the data being transmitted.

Finally, the data management layer colles, processes, and analyzes the data generated by devices, commonly utilizing cloudbased services or onpremises solutions. Effeive data management enables realtime analytics, allowing organizations to derive aionable insights from their conneed solutions. Additionally, a robust backend architeure ensures efficient storage, retrieval, and processing of large volumes of data generated by IoT devices.

2. Development Stages of IoT Solutions

Once the architeure is established, the next step involves developing the IoT solution. The development process typically follows several stages, starting with ideation and requirement gathering. Understanding user needs and defining clear objeives are essential to create a tailored IoT solution that solves real problems. Collaborating with stakeholders during this phase can offer diverse perspeives and insights, ultimately contributing to a more comprehensive solution.

The prototyping stage is crucial for testing assumptions and validating the feasibility of the proposed solution. This may involve creating Minimum Viable Produs (s) that encompass the core features of the final produ. Rapid prototyping fosters iterative development, allowing teams to gather feedback early and make necessary adjustments before moving to fullscale implementation. Tools and platforms that offer IoTspecific funionalities can significantly expedite the prototyping phase.

Once the prototype is validated, organizations can scale their solutions to serve a broader audience. This phase necessitates extensive testing and refining to ensure reliability, performance, and user satisfaion. It is vital to maintain clear documentation throughout the process, ensuring that the application can be efficiently maintained and expanded over time. Moreover, plans for gradual scaling are imperative to accommodate increasing numbers of users and devices, optimizing resource allocation effeively.

3. Security Considerations in IoT

With an increasing number of conneed devices, security remains a paramount issue in IoT development. Vulnerabilities in any component of the IoT architeure can compromise the entire system, leading to unauthorized access or data breaches. Consequently, incorporating security best praices throughout the development process is essential. This begins with implementing secure coding praices and ensuring that all devices have builtin security features from manufaure.

Moreover, data encryption should be a standard praice for proteing sensitive information transferred across networks. Both dataatrest and dataintransit encryption adds extra layers of proteion, making it considerably more challenging for unauthorized parties to access valuable information. Regular software updates and patches are also crucial in defending against emerging cyber threats and vulnerabilities.

Lastly, organizations should develop a comprehensive incident response plan to address potential breaches swiftly. Establishing protocols for monitoring system aivities, identifying anomalies, and responding to security incidents can minimize the impa of security breaches. Employee training and awareness regarding cybersecurity praices further bolster IoT security, ensuring that all staff members are vigilant in safeguarding the network.

4. Future Trends in IoT

As technology continues to evolve, several trends are emerging in the IoT landscape that promise to transform the way conneed solutions are developed and deployed. One significant trend is the integration of edge computing into IoT architeures. By processing data closer to where it is generated rather than relying solely on cloud processing, edge computing reduces latency, enhances performance, and alleviates bandwidth constraints.

Another notable trend is the increasing use of artificial intelligence (AI) and machine learning (ML) in IoT applications. These technologies enable smarter data processing and analytics, allowing devices to learn from past behaviors and make informed decisions autonomously. AIpowered IoT solutions can optimize resource usage, forecast maintenance needs, and improve user experiences significantly.

Finally, the adoption of standardized protocols is gaining momentum, fostering interoperability among various IoT devices and platforms. Standardization aids in streamlining the development process, ensuring that multiple devices can communicate seamlessly within the same ecosystem. As more industries embrace IoT solutions, adherence to standards will play a crucial role in ensuring scalability and compatibility of conneed devices.

Summary: In conclusion, building an IoT platform involves a multifaceted approach that encompasses understanding architeure, following struured development stages, prioritizing security, and staying abreast of emerging trends. By focusing on these critical aspes, organizations can successfully develop and deploy conneed solutions, unlocking vast possibilities and enhancing operational efficiencies. The future of IoT is bright, with continuous innovation set to drive forth new advancements and applications, further solidifying the role of IoT in our daily lives and industries.

Previous article:Exploring Leading Brands Excel...

Next article: Unlock Your Online Potential: ...

What you might be interested in

What you might also be interested in